Private Training includes one-on-one in-person coaching, a home-study course, and accountability support to guide owners step-by-step. The Board and Train program involves the dog staying at the facility for intensive training, with owners receiving follow-up lessons to maintain progress. Both programs require owner participation and commitment to consistent practice at home. Training is structured around behavior modification and obedience, with tools like prong collars and e-collars used under professional guidance.

About the Trainer
Intelligent K9 is a dog training business based in Richmond, Virginia, led by CJ, a former US Marine and professional skydiver with 15 years of dog training experience. They offer personalized training solutions focused on transforming unwanted behaviors and building a stronger bond between dogs and their owners. Their approach combines a balanced method that uses both positive motivation and humane corrections to teach dogs what to do and what not to do, aiming for reliable obedience without constant treats or corrections. Services include private one-on-one training with in-person coaching and a home-study course, as well as board and train programs. They specialize in behavior modification for issues like leash reactivity, jumping, barking, potty training, and separation anxiety. Clients are encouraged to actively participate and commit to consistent practice. Training occurs at their facility in Powhatan, Virginia, located 10 minutes from Midlothian. They also provide ongoing support via text and video for continued success.
They serve dog owners in Richmond and surrounding areas, including Glen Allen and Powhatan, and offer free consultations to assess needs and match clients with the right program. Their training tools include prong collars, e-collars, clickers, and harnesses, with guidance on proper usage. They emphasize leadership, consistency, and communication as key to long-term success.
The business is known for its responsive customer service, with CJ personally available for questions and follow-ups, even recording custom videos for clients. Many clients report dramatic improvements in their dogs’ behavior and their own confidence as trainers.
They also offer pack walks and ongoing support after program completion to help maintain progress.
